swear的基本意思是“咒罵”,指用污穢的語言對某人或某物進行攻擊,造成精神上的傷害。swear還可指明確或鄭重地向某人保證某事,即“發誓”。
swear可用作及物動詞,也可用作不及物動詞。用作及物動詞時,后接名詞、代詞、動詞不定式或that從句作賓語,還可接以形容詞充當補足語的復合賓語。可用于被動結構。
swear表示“罵人”時,其后須與介詞at連用。
swear的過去式是swore,過去分詞是sworn。
☆ 直接源自古英語的swerian,意為宣誓。

用作動詞(v.)
咒罵(某人),詛咒(某事) speak curses to (sb or sth)His boss often swore at him, sometimes for no reason at all.
老板經常罵他,有時毫無理由。
The foreman swore at his workers.
工頭咒罵工人。
Glen leant out of the car window and swore at another driver.
格倫將身子探出車窗,咒罵另一個司機。
He could hear them shouting and swearing at each other.
他聽到他們在大叫大嚷,互相咒罵。
Why did you swear at missing the bus?
誤了一班車你罵個什么?
He resented being sworn at.
他憎恨別人罵他。
